MINUTES OF THE MEETING OF THE DOWNTOWN
DEVELOPMENT AUTHORITY
WHICH TOOK PLACE ON WEDNESDAY, OCTOBER 10, 2007
COUNCIL CHAMBERS, CITY HALL, MIDLAND, MICHIGAN
Denise Hufford read Roll Call.
PRESENT: DDA MEMBERS – Bo Brines, Doug Chapman, Mike Hayes, Jack McCandless,
Ranny Riecker, Jim Stamas, Claudia Wallin
ABSENT: Jenny Anderson,
Fr. Fleming, Paula Liveris, Jon Lynch, Sue Rabbage, Mark Ruhle
PRESENT: STAFF – Denise Hufford, Stephanie
Szostak, Keith Baker
PRESENT: OTHERS –
Rich Pomeroy
Wallin called the meeting to order
at 3:00 p.m.
1.
Approval of past meeting minutes
Motion
to approve the September 12, 2007 meeting minutes by McCandless. Seconded by
Riecker. Approved unanimously.
2.
Reports
a)
Design Committee
Chapman
showed the design for a downtown kiosk. Features include a business listing
that is changeable. To be installed in spring 2008.
Chapman
reported that there is an action item to approve the façade loan request by
Rich Pomeroy for the former Baringer’s Men Shop. Rich Pomeroy gave a brief
overview of the project including an invitation to the board to come to the
open house once construction is complete.
Chapman
asked for approval of the action item:
The Downtown Development Authority Board of Directors hereby approves the Façade Loan in the amount of $15,000 for façade improvements at the building owned by Rich Pomeroy located at 129 E. Main Street, upon execution of a personal and business guarantee.
Seconded
by Stamas. Approved unanimously.
Baker
reported that the Redevelopment and Design study has given the board one more
week to make any suggestions for changes. Email your changes to Baker or Hufford.
Final report will be brought to the board at the November meeting for approval.
b)
Horticulture Report
Szostak
reported that the annuals have been removed, baskets and pots put away for the
winter, bulbs have been planted, soil drenching completed, and mums have been
planted. Tree lights for corner trees will be installed by the October 18
Pumpkin Festival. Irrigation should be turned off next week, and the day lily
division project will be worked on as time permits this fall.
Szostak
will present the 2008 Annual design at the November meeting.
c)
Organization Committee
Baker
reported that the search for an Executive Director for the DDA continues.
Twelve applications have been received so far. The search remains open until
October 19. Applicants must fill out a City of Midland job application form,
available at www.midland-mi.org. The
search committee will meet on October 29 to review applications.
Hufford
will set up a budget committee meeting. All sub-committees should review their
budgets for the coming year.
d)
Economic Restructuring Committee
Hayes
reported 8 downtown vacancies for lease and one property for sale. New business
called Tri-City Nutrition will offer 31 flavors of smoothies and other health
foods sometime in November.
Hayes
presented the new downtown business recruitment packet. Can be updated and used
as a marketing tool for downtown.
e)
Creating Cool Committee
Wallin
reported the new downtown website is up and running. A few minor glitches, but overall
seems to be working well.
Wallin
reported that the Google Headquarters in Ann Arbor, Michigan invited Midland to
decorate one of their conference rooms. The DDA sent event posters along with a
replica of the red wagon to promote the 100 Best Communities to Raise Young
Children Award received this year. The Chamber of Commerce is coordinating this
project. Hayes reported that this room has been named “The Midland Room.”
Wallin
reported upcoming events including Mannequin Night (10/11), Pumpkin Festival
(10/18), Santa Parade (11/17), Santa’s Arrival and Courthouse Lighting (11/27),
and Breakfast with Santa (12/1). Tickets for Breakfast with Santa go on sale
November 1st.
f)
Midland Downtown Business Association
Hufford
reported that Mannequin Night is tomorrow night, October 11, from 6:30-8 pm and
is a joint venture with Northwood University’s Fashion Department. Pumpkin
Festival is Thursday, October 18 from 6-7:30 pm and features many fun pumpkin
events.
Hufford
reported that the DDA Board is invited to attend the Michigan Main Street
Annual Review on Wednesday, October 31 from 11:30am – 1 pm at Ashman Court
Hotel.
Public Comments
None.
Old Business
Strategic
Planning will be held in January. Hufford will contact Board Members to find
convenient dates.
New Business
None.
Adjourn
There was
no further business to come before the Board. McCandless moved that the meeting
be adjourned. Hayes seconded. Meeting adjourned at 3:22 p.m.

ACTION ITEM
The Midland Downtown Development Authority (DDA) selected
Hamilton Anderson Associates of Detroit, Michigan to prepare a Downtown
Redevelopment and Design Plan. The plan identifies new potential development
opportunities and defines physical enhancement projects within the
downtown. The plan includes a market study for downtown housing. The
plan identifies opportunities for new housing within the downtown and methods
for improving the pedestrian environment that connects the downtown to existing
neighborhoods.
The final plan, dated November, 2007 is now complete. The DDA requests the adoption of this plan by the Downtown Development Authority Board.
The Downtown Development Authority Board of Directors hereby approves the adoption of the 2007 Hamilton Anderson Redevelopment and Design Study for the Downtown Development Authority.
